Patent number: 8662118Abstract: A coupling has a housing which defines a vacuum chamber and, at least in part, a nozzle chamber. The nozzle chamber forms a valve chamber, an intake chamber, and an outlet chamber. A main valve is in the valve chamber. The main valve is movable between an open and closed position. A poppet valve is in the outlet chamber. An air outlet opens from the vacuum chamber into the nozzle chamber. An opening of an air uptake conduit opens into the vacuum chamber. The air outlet opening is distinct from the opening of the uptake conduit. When the main valve is in the open position the valve chamber is open to the outlet chamber and the outlet chamber is open to the intake chamber. In the closed position, the valve chamber is sealed off from the outlet chamber and the intake chamber is sealed off from the outlet chamber.Type: GrantFiled: December 1, 2011Date of Patent: March 4, 2014Assignee: EMCO Wheaton Corp.Inventors: Gary Wilson Hunt, Mark Andrew Pettenuzzo

Patent number: 7758234Abstract: The present invention is directed to a light emitting wiring device for selectively illuminating a space. The device includes a housing including a plurality of wiring terminals configured to be connected to a source of electrical power. A circuit is disposed in the housing. The circuit is configured to provide an output signal in response to at least one external input signal. The device also includes an emission-detection assembly includes a lamp sub-assembly coupled to the at least one circuit. The lamp sub-assembly includes at least one light emitting element configured to emit light in response to the output signal. An ambient light sensor sub-assembly is coupled to the at least one circuit and includes an ambient light sensor and a sensor housing assembly. The ambient light sensor is configured to generate the at least one external input signal in response to an ambient light level in the space.Type: GrantFiled: December 5, 2005Date of Patent: July 20, 2010Assignee: Pass & Seymour, Inc.Inventors: Gerald R. Savicki, Jr., Jeffrey C. Richards, David A. Finlay, Sr., Gary Wilson

Patent number: 7622196Abstract: The invented method of cladding a metal component includes creating a frit mixture in a defined ratio; wetting the mixture by adding a wetting agent in a defined volume; agitating the wetted mixture; applying the agitated mixture to a metal component by one or more processes; de-wetting the metal component having the applied mixture by gradually heating the same to a temperature from approximately 250 degrees Fahrenheit (° F.) up to a high of approximately 450° F.; and, fusing the de-wetted metal component at a temperature of no more than 125% of a defined withstand temperature for the clad metal component. Invented compositions can include one or more of liquid and/or colloidal sodium, potassium and/or lithium silicate, clay and/or clays, a compound of hollow micro-spheres (e.g.Type: GrantFiled: August 11, 2006Date of Patent: November 24, 2009Assignee: Applied Technology Laboratories LLCInventor: Gary Wilson
